2 Coca Cola Scholars from Aqsa out of 95,000 applicants! Amineh Ayyad and Amatullah Mir you make us proud!!!
From more than 95,000 applicants from across the country to 1,896 Semifinalists to 251 Regional Finalists, to the 150 NATIONAL Coca-Cola Scholars, and TWO are from AQSA SCHOOL!!!!!!!!
We could NOT be more proud to have TWO of our wonderful Aqsa seniors, Amineh Ayyad and Amatullah Mir, be named NATIONAL Coca Cola SCHOLARS!
What does it mean to be a Coca-Cola Scholar?
It's one of the top honors in the country.
A Coca-Cola Scholar not only exemplifies superior leadership, service, and academics - they are change agents, positively affecting others in their community.
These extraordinary humans are already filling society’s coffers with bolder action, more amazing technology, bigger advancements, healthier futures, and exponential possibility.
As Coca-Cola Scholars, they received:
- a $20,000 college scholarship
- the experience of a lifetime at Scholars Weekend in Atlanta, where they were celebrated at the 31st annual Scholars Banquet on April 4 and participated in our Leadership Development Insitute
- a new family of 6,300+ Coca-Cola Scholar alumni to encourage, challenge, and support them in a shared goal to make the world a better place

JUNIOR ACHIEVEMENT $40,000 SCHOLARSHIP to Aqsa Senior!
This year 2 seniors were finalists: Amineh Ayyad and Zahra Bennett
Congratulations to Aqsa School seniors Amineh Ayyad and Zahra Bennett this year's Junior Achievement of Chicago Scholarship recipients!!
Scholarships were presented by Aqsa School Class of 2018 alumna and Junior Achievement scholar Illiana Sughayer! We are so proud of them all, mashAllah.
Students were awarded for high academic achievement and superb applications among a large pool of applicants. Amineh is the recipient of the highly competitive Colonel Henry Crown *$40,000* scholarship.
